find (included file)
Ce fichier find.inc.c n'est pas un fichier de fonction. Il doit être inclus dans le fichier source mkd.c avec la directive incluse dans find.inc.h selon que le fichier de projet est reconnu ou non.
find.inc.c, find.inc.h 2013-05-09
